Johannisberg Dry Riesling
|
|
The character of this fine German varietal is
truly distinctive. Displays a flowery bouquet, complex fruit and
cinnamon flavours and a crisp, clean finish. Versatile in pairing
with foods, especially seafood, pork or veal.
Sweetness:
Dry | Body:
Light-Medium | Oak
Intensity:
None

The town of Piesport in the Mosel-Saar-Ruwer wine
region has an ideal steep amphitheater site perfect for producing
sound, honeyed, delicate wines. Our version captures the classic
flavour and magical fragrance of this respected German style through
the addition of our F-pack and a special package of dried
elderflowers.

Crisp and flavourful, this popular grape varietal
has distinctive and immediately recognizable aroma and flavour
characteristics. The famous grassy, herbaceous bouquet and flinty
aftertaste are here, with the generous acidity that is typical of
the grape. Steely, grassy, and defiantly dry, nothing can complement
a meal better than Sauvignon Blanc, a unique wine that offers a
definitive counterpoint to the ubiquitous Chardonnay.
